Technical
Specification:
- 28mm
timber walls with bevelled notches for simple
construction and better seal compared to straight
cut notches.
- 19mm
roof and floor boards.
- 80mm
x 60mm Pressure treated floor bearers to protect
against decay and insect infestation.
- 134mm
x 38mm heavy duty Roof beams, pre-notched for
slotting on to apexes
- Storm
protection beams are supplied to secure the upper
wall section to the lower sections of the wall.
- All
components are already cut for simple construction,
all timber is planed and notched. All screws and
nails needed are supplied.
- Top
wall sections for front and back walls are cut to
the angle of the roof to aid the nailing down of the
roof boards.
- Window
ready to slot into place.
- Double
door is supplied as 6 assembled parts that fit
together and slot into place.
